Earwax accumulation is a very common problem. Earwax is closely related to our health. Earwax is also called cerumen and is made up of dead cells, fat and tiny hairs.

If too much wax has accumulated then it is very important to remove it, otherwise it can have a bad effect on the ears.

This may also cause ear pain, infection or some other problems. In this article, we will know what other problems can occur due to accumulation of earwax.

Difficulty hearing

Excessive accumulation of earwax in the ear can block the ear canal, which leads to reduced hearing ability. This condition is especially common in the elderly.

pain in ear

Excessive accumulation of earwax can cause pain and discomfort. This pain can be persistent and sometimes even severe.

Ringing in the ears

Excess earwax can cause tinnitus, a condition that causes ringing, buzzing, or other types of noises in the ears.

itching in ears

Excessive earwax buildup can lead to itching and ear infections. This becomes the ideal environment for bacteria and fungus to grow, leading to problems like otitis externa.

Dizziness

Excessive accumulation of earwax can put pressure on the inner ear and affect the vestibular system, which senses balance and position.
